A Deeper Dive
What many users might not realize is that this level of personalization relies heavily on data collection. Every click, every search, and every video watched contributes to a vast database. This data is then used to create a unique profile, shaping the content we see and the ads we encounter. While it's fascinating to witness such precision, it also raises questions about privacy and control.
The Trade-Off
When we choose to 'Accept all' cookies, we're essentially granting platforms like YouTube access to our digital footprints. This trade-off is a modern-day dilemma. On one side, we gain a seemingly infinite stream of personalized content. On the other, we sacrifice a degree of anonymity and control over our online presence.
A Balancing Act
Here's the intriguing part: by opting for 'Reject all' cookies, we can maintain a certain level of privacy. However, this choice also limits the platform's ability to offer tailored experiences. It's a delicate balance, and one that requires users to actively engage with their privacy settings.
